    About a decade in the past, I began noticing that sure garments made my pores and skin itch. Like, loads. Then my toddler son was identified with eczema, painful rashes that coated his legs and arms. I began shopping for the gentlest detergents I might discover and checking material content material labels on all our garments. When I began paying slightly extra for denims, the gnarly itching stopped.

    Was it psychosomatic? Do I cease itching solely when swaddled within the best of jeans and cotton flannel tank tops? According to style and sustainability journalist Alden Wicker, who runs the web site Ecocult and just lately printed the guide To Dye For, your garments actually may very well be making you sick. Quite a lot of quick style is made out of polyester, which requires particular dyes. Manufacturers then add wrinkle- or stain-resistant brokers, or spray material for soft-touch finishes. Finally, entire shipments get dusted with fungicides or pesticides to make all of it the way in which all over the world with out getting eaten by moths.

    Over the years, I managed to search out garments that didn’t make us itch. But underwear was a giant drawback. Breathable cotton underwear is healthier on your well being down there and I simply don’t just like the slick, slimy really feel of principally nylon or polyester gadgets. But I additionally like working, tenting, mountain climbing, skateboarding, and biking. Cotton doesn’t dry quick sufficient when it’s simply sitting on a rock within the solar. This is the place Branwyn’s merino wool set is available in.

    Run-derwear

    Branwyn makes what they name merino wool efficiency units. I’m a fan of merino wool for a lot of causes. It’s a naturally renewable fiber that doesn’t leach microplastics into our water, earth, and air. It’s additionally moisture-wicking, naturally odor-repellent, and shockingly good at regulating your physique temperature, whether or not you’re actually scorching or actually chilly. Merino sheep can not change their garments when it will get too scorching or too chilly, so their wool does plenty of the work for them.

    Branwyn’s garments are Oeko-Tex 100 licensed, which implies each element of the clothes has been independently examined in opposition to a listing of as much as 350 poisonous chemical substances. This is likely one of the most widely-known and revered labels for client security; the corporate additionally meets just a few different well-known impartial sustainability and ethics requirements, like Reach compliance and ZQ merino certification.

    Branwyn despatched me the Essential Bralette ($48) and Essential Bikini ($36). I consulted the dimensions chart and each match true to measurement. (I suppose it’s necessary to notice right here that I’m a small-busted girl and that Branwyn makes a Busty Bra ($58) for those who want extra assist.)

    I do know the phrase “wool underwear” conjures a psychological picture of some lumberjack from the 1800s with hair rising by way of the weaves of his itchy, scorching lengthy johns. (I additionally stay in Portland, Oregon, so I might stroll by a person like this immediately.) However, Branwyn’s material is 80 p.c merino, with 20 p.c nylon thrown in there for a little bit of consolation and stretch. Thankfully, the nylon hasn’t but made me itch.
